#dcb1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dcb1ec is composed of 86.3% red, 69.4%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.8% cyan, 25%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 283.7 degrees, a saturation of 60.8% and a lightness of 81%. #dcb1ec color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b963d9.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

#dcb1ec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dcb1ec has RGB values of R:220, G:177, B:236 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 14463468.
